Moonstone Villa - Five Bedroom Villa, Sleeps 12
Nestled in a picturesque corner overlooking the Wye Valley and the Brecon Beacons beyond, Moonstone Villa stands as a beacon of Georgian elegance with a modern twist. Located just a stone’s throw from the enchanting Forest of Dean, this remarkable house invites you to indulge in a getaway that blends history with comfort.
Step through the door and you are greeted by a blend of Georgian grandeur and contemporary charm. The interiors, generously proportioned yet invitingly warm, boast chandeliers casting a gentle glow, walls adorned with tasteful artwork, and antique pieces that hint at stories from ages past. It is not just about historical opulence here – this is a place meant for living and laughter, where every room exudes a welcoming atmosphere.
The heart of the home is a delightful mix of spaces. The drawing room, with its peacock-themed turquoise sofas, beckons for relaxed evenings by the fire, while the adjacent sitting room, with its oatmeal Chesterfield, promises cosy conversations over a cuppa. A grand dining room invites shared meals around a polished table, complemented by a kitchen that is a joy for any aspiring chef.
Venture upstairs and discover five bedrooms, each a sanctuary of comfort and style. Whether it is the super-king-size bed with its luxurious en-suite, complete with a deep bath and separate shower, or the room boasting a roll-top bath beneath a bay window, every space offers a retreat from the day's adventures. Even the twin bunk bedded room is equipped with its own TV for moments of quiet relaxation.
Yet, it is the outdoors that truly captivates. Framed by elegant Georgian windows, the garden unfolds with a mesmerising view that stretches to the horizon. Here, you can unwind in a bubbling hot tub, gather for al fresco meals amidst ample seating, or simply wander through the lovingly landscaped two-acre grounds.
For those inclined to explore further, the surrounding area offers endless possibilities. A short drive brings you to the historic town of Ross-on-Wye or the wild woodlands of the Forest of Dean, perfect for a day of hiking or cycling. Nearby, quaint pubs like The Alma beckon with hearty meals and local charm, while fishing lakes and golf courses promise leisurely pursuits just a stone’s throw away.
In essence, Moonstone Villa is not just a holiday retreat – it is a gateway to moments of shared joy and tranquillity in one of the most beautiful corners of the UK. Whether you are escaping for a weekend or settling in for a week, this haven promises an unforgettable stay steeped in both elegance and comfort.
